With the first prototype it became apparent that the more simplified the interface then the less confusing the user paths would be for the user. Notes have been taken to implement these new suggestions from the critique such as moving the links about and help to the footer of the page and keep only what is necessary in the navigation bar. Also have a simplified user dashboard for the user so that they can choose to either continue their story, manage their profile or manage their team. In the first prototype many of those items were jumbled onto the user profile page when really it should be a simple launch point for the user.
